    G Willow Wilson has chimed in. Echoing previous statements about Ellis and saying that she witnessed predatory behavior herself

    Most importantly she says it was an extremely open secret that in the late 90s-00s (she left comics for a time after so she can't comment on the period afterwards) that he did it and that essentially every professional in comics knew. Ellis was one of the gatekeepers at the time and if you were breaking into the business he, and a handful of other writers and artists, you had to make a good impression and get in their good graces. That was the only way in. There were no hiring initiatives or talent searches or even applications. It was entirely who you knew.

    Which makes a WHOLE LOT of big name comic creators seem, at best, complicit in this horrid behavior and at worst, abusers themselves.

    DC produced this for Juneteenth, with art from Denys Cowan.

    Putting aside the fact that they couldn't even fill the graphic without doing repeats (SUPERMAN OF EARTH 23 is on there 3 times.)

    Naomi is a very noticeable absence. She's a new character, has a high profile and had her own solo book just last year but she ain't shown or named.

    Her name is Naomi McDuffie in honor of the late Dwayne McDuffie, something her creators got permission for from his widow.

    Denys Cowan is currently embroiled in a legal battle with said widow because he and the other Milestone founders cut her out of the rights and profits of Milestone by just...forming a new LLC and transferring the rights without including her.
